1. Effects of lead intake on children
Studies show that children’s absorption rate of lead is as high as 40%, which is much higher than that of adults. Where lead pollution is severe, children are more likely to develop mental retardation. Not only that, lead poisoning can also cause problems such as ADHD, inattention, and poor memory in children.
2. Effects of cadmium intake on children
As a heavy metal, cadmium is listed as a toxic substance that is harmful to human health. The intake of cadmium has a greater impact on the kidneys and bones of the human body, and may even damage the nervous system, and accumulation and accumulation in the body will produce toxicity and cause cancer.
3. Effects of manganese intake on children
Human intake of proper amount of manganese can promote human growth and normal bone formation. However, if it is excessive, it can cause chronic poisoning, which affects the central nervous system of adolescents, leading to decreased memory and IQ.
